Mi az az Uplock az adatbázisokban?
Az Uplock (az "frissítési zár" rövidítése) egy olyan mechanizmus, amelyet az adatbázisokban használnak annak biztosítására, hogy egy adott sort egyszerre csak egy felhasználó frissíthessen. Általában a pesszimista párhuzamosság-szabályozással együtt használatos, ahol az adatbázis zárolást szerez a sorban, mielőtt módosítaná azt.
Ha egy felhasználó megpróbál frissíteni egy sort, amelyik feloldással rendelkezik, az adatbázis ellenőrzi, hogy vannak-e jelenleg más felhasználók zárakat tartva azon a sorban. Ha vannak, a frissítés le lesz tiltva, amíg a többi felhasználó fel nem oldja a zárolást. Ez biztosítja, hogy egyszerre csak egy felhasználó tudja frissíteni a sort, megelőzve az adatok következetlenségét és a versenyfeltételeket.
A feltöltéseket általában olyan helyzetekben használják, amikor az adatok konzisztenciája kritikus, például pénzügyi tranzakciók vagy készletkezelés során. Használhatók bizonyos adatokhoz való kizárólagos hozzáférést igénylő üzleti szabályok betartatására is.
Érdemes megjegyezni, hogy a feloldásoknak kihatásai lehetnek a teljesítményre, mivel nem körültekintő használat esetén vitákhoz és holtpontokhoz vezethetnek. Fontos, hogy megfontoltan és csak akkor használd a feltöltéseket, ha az adatok konzisztenciája érdekében szükséges.



